Understanding Long-Lasting Asphalt Driveway Options

When considering long-lasting asphalt driveway options for your residential property, it’s crucial to understand the material’s inherent durability and the diverse range of choices available in the market. Asphalt paving, a popular choice among homeowners, offers an excellent balance between cost-effectiveness and longevity when compared to concrete. According to industry reports, asphalt driveways can last up to 25 years with proper maintenance, outperforming many other surface options.
One key aspect to consider is the various types of asphalt paving available. Hot mix asphalt, for instance, is a common choice due to its versatility and affordability. This mixture combines aggregate stones, sand, and bitumen bound together through heat treatment. It provides a smooth surface, easy installation, and good resistance to wear and tear. For those seeking a more aesthetically pleasing option, decorative asphalt paving techniques offer a range of colors and patterns, allowing homeowners to personalize their driveways while maintaining durability.
However, it’s essential to weigh the advantages of asphalt against other materials like concrete. While concrete is known for its strength, asphalt surpasses it in terms of flexibility, making it less susceptible to cracks and damage from shifting soil or heavy traffic. Additionally, asphalt paving costs significantly less upfront than concrete, making it a more budget-friendly choice for residential properties. Despite the benefits, proper maintenance is vital to ensure longevity. Regular sealing and repair can protect against environmental factors, such as UV rays and severe weather, which may cause deterioration over time. Factors Affecting Asphalt Driveway Durability

The durability of an asphalt driveway is influenced by several key factors, ensuring its longevity and preserving the investment made in residential asphalt paving. One of the primary considerations is the quality of the initial installation. A skilled paving company employing industry best practices during construction can significantly enhance the lifespan of the driveway. This includes proper compaction, accurate grade alignment, and using high-quality materials to withstand local climate conditions. For instance, colder climates may require additional measures to prevent damage from frost heaves.
Regular asphalt repair techniques play a crucial role in maintaining durability over time. Cracks, holes, and other surface imperfections can weaken the structure, allowing water penetration that further deteriorates the pavement. Homeowners should be vigilant in monitoring these issues and promptly address them. Professional paving companies often offer routine maintenance packages that include crack sealing and surface repairs, ensuring the driveway remains in top condition. As a practical example, studies show that regular maintenance can extend the life of an asphalt driveway by up to 50%, saving homeowners significant costs in the long run.
Another aspect to consider is the appropriate paving thickness for residential alleys or driveways. Insufficient thickness results in reduced durability and increased vulnerability to damage from heavy vehicles or extreme weather conditions. Residential Asphalt Paving: Best Practices

When considering residential asphalt paving options, it’s crucial to understand best practices for a driveway installation company near me. The process involves careful planning, expert execution, and adherence to local asphalt paving regulations. Start by assessing your property’s unique characteristics, including terrain, sun exposure, and traffic patterns. This informs the choice between various asphalt paving equipment and techniques suitable for your needs. For instance, hot mix asphalt is a popular option due to its durability and cost-effectiveness; it’s produced using heated aggregates at a plant, then delivered and laid by specialized equipment.
A key aspect of successful residential asphalt paving lies in preparation. Proper grading ensures water drainage, preventing potholes and cracks. Sub-base installation provides a solid foundation by compacting base materials to bear the weight of traffic. Then, precise leveling and texturing create an even surface ready for the final layer of asphalt. This multi-step approach, combined with adherence to industry standards, guarantees longevity. According to the National Asphalt Paving Association (NAPA), properly maintained asphalt driveways can last 20-30 years or more with minimal repair.
Regular maintenance is indeed essential for prolonging the life of your newly paved driveway. This includes sealing cracks, re-sealing and striping as needed, and addressing any damage promptly. Maintenance Tips to Extend Your Driveway's Life

Extending the life of your residential asphalt driveway involves a combination of thoughtful maintenance practices and expert installation techniques. To ensure your driveway stands the test of time, consider these in-depth tips that delve into both preventive care and optimal residential asphalt paving methods. Regular cleaning is paramount; removing oil stains, leaf debris, and other contaminants before they penetrate the surface helps maintain its integrity. A simple solution of water, detergent, and a stiff brush can be highly effective. Additionally, sealing your driveway annually with a high-quality sealer creates a protective barrier against moisture, UV rays, and extreme temperatures—all factors that contribute to asphalt deterioration.
The residential asphalt installation process itself plays a significant role in longevity. Professional contractors should employ best practices such as proper base preparation, utilizing compacted aggregate bases or subbases for enhanced stability, and ensuring adequate drainage to prevent water pooling. These measures, coupled with high-quality materials and expert techniques, can significantly prolong the lifespan of your driveway, potentially lasting 20 years or more with minimal maintenance.
Cost considerations are also crucial. The national average for residential paving ranges from $3,500 to $8,000, depending on factors like size, condition, and local labor costs. While this may seem substantial, investing in quality installation and routine maintenance can save you from costly repairs down the line. For instance, a study by the National Asphalt Paving Association (NAPA) found that properly maintained asphalt surfaces can last up to 30 years, significantly reducing long-term expenses compared to frequent repairs or replacements.
Furthermore, staying informed about local climate conditions and adjusting your maintenance routine accordingly is essential. In colder regions, for example, proper winterization techniques, including sealing and sand addition, can prevent ice damage and cracks.
